My problem originated with the rear wiper not working. Then if I opened and closed the rear hatch, it would work for a couple of days. Now it has quit altogether. Looking at the wiring schematic, I noticed that the ground for the rear hatch light and wiper ground go through a switch. So I assumed that my problem was the switch. I'm thinking after reading your post that it may be an intermittent open in the wiring harness where it gets stressed from the opening and closing of the rear door.
I'll get a volt / ohm meter out and start looking further.
